John Ogu Set To Make League Debut Against Beitar Jerusalem
Published: September 12, 2014
Super Eagles midfielder John Ogu is set to make his league debut for Hapoel Beer Sheva when they clash with Beitar Jerusalem in the opening round of the Israeli Premier League on Saturday.
At the start of the week, the 26 - year - old completed his transfer to the Camels by signing a four - year contract.
Also expected to make the starting lineup is Austin Ejide after returning from international duty with the Nigeria squad.
Hapoel Beer Sheva, league runners-up last term, are without a win in six matches, including two Europa League games against Split of Croatia.
For the remainder of this season, John Ogu will don the number 12 shirt while Austin Ejide gets to keep his number one jersey.
